Risk Metrics and Stability
AGPXX exhibits a strong correlation with its benchmark, with a correlation coefficient of 99.08%, indicating that it closely tracks the performance of short-term treasury securities. Despite its negative alpha of -0.16% and Sharpe ratio of -0.11, the fund’s standard deviation of 0.42% suggests low volatility, which is typical for money market funds. The fund’s downside risk is effectively zero, as indicated by its downside risk (UI) metric, making it a stable choice for risk-averse investors. The absence of a max drawdown further underscores its stability and reliability as a safe investment vehicle.
Portfolio Composition and Asset Allocation
The portfolio of AGPXX is primarily composed of cash and government securities, with cash making up 72.73% and government bonds accounting for 27.27% of the total assets. This conservative asset allocation strategy ensures high liquidity and minimal risk, aligning with the fund’s objective of capital preservation. The top holdings include various tri-party repos and U.S. Treasury bills, which are known for their safety and liquidity. This composition is ideal for investors who prioritize security and quick access to their funds, as it minimizes exposure to market fluctuations.
